Understanding How Pregnancy Tests Work

Pregnancy tests detect the presence of human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G), a hormone produced by the placenta after a fertilized egg attaches to the uterine lining. The level of hCG in your body increases rapidly in the early stages of pregnancy, doubling every 48 to 72 hours. Cheap pregnancy tests, like their more expensive counterparts, are designed to detect this hormone in your urine. However, the sensitivity of these tests can vary, which affects how early they can detect pregnancy.

When Can You Take a Cheap Pregnancy Test?

The earliest you can take a cheap pregnancy test depends on when implantation occurs. Implantation typically happens 6 to 12 days after ovulation, and hCG production begins shortly after. Most cheap pregnancy tests claim to detect hCG levels as low as 25 mIU/mL, which is usually achieved about 10 to 14 days after conception. However, taking the test too early can result in a false negative, as hCG levels may not yet be high enough to detect.

Factors That Affect Test Accuracy

Several factors can influence the accuracy of a cheap pregnancy test, including:

  • Test Sensitivity: Tests with lower hCG detection thresholds can provide earlier results.
  • Timing: Testing too early or at the wrong time of day can affect results.
  • Urine Concentration: First-morning urine is typically the most concentrated and ideal for testing.
  • User Error: Misreading the instructions or results can lead to inaccurate outcomes.

What to Do If You Get a Negative Result

If you take a cheap pregnancy test and get a negative result but still suspect you might be pregnant, wait a few days and test again. hCG levels increase rapidly in early pregnancy, and a test taken a few days later may yield a positive result. If you continue to experience pregnancy symptoms or have concerns, consult a healthcare professional for further evaluation.
